PHP является одним из самых популярных языков программирования для веб-разработки и может использоваться для стилизации сообщений электронной почты.
Для начала, чтобы отправить сообщение по электронной почте с помощью PHP, вы можете использовать функцию mail()
. Она принимает несколько аргументов, включая адрес получателя, тему сообщения и его содержание. Обычно сообщение представляет собой HTML-код, который позволяет вам стилизовать его в соответствии с вашими потребностями.
Вот пример кода, демонстрирующий отправку HTML-письма с помощью функции mail()
:
$to = '[email protected]'; $subject = 'Тема письма'; $message = '<html> <head> <title>Стилизация сообщений на почту</title> <style> /* Здесь можно добавить стили для вашего сообщения */ </style> </head> <body> <h1>Привет, мир!</h1> <p>Это пример стилизованного HTML-сообщения.</p> </body> </html>'; $headers = "MIME-Version: 1.0" . "rn"; $headers .= "Content-type:text/html;charset=UTF-8" . "rn"; if(mail($to, $subject, $message, $headers)) { echo 'Сообщение успешно отправлено'; } else { echo 'Ошибка отправки сообщения'; }
В этом примере мы создали HTML-код для сообщения и добавили его в переменную $message
. Затем мы добавляем заголовки, которые указывают, что сообщение является HTML-письмом. Заголовки передаются в функцию mail()
в виде строки.
Вы можете добавлять любые стили в блок <style></style>
, чтобы настроить внешний вид вашего сообщения. Например, вы можете изменить цвет, шрифт, размер и положение текста, добавить изображения или фоновую картинку и многое другое. Вы также можете использовать CSS-фреймворки, такие как Bootstrap, для создания более сложных и привлекательных дизайнов.
Однако стоит помнить, что не все почтовые клиенты полностью поддерживают CSS и могут игнорировать некоторые стили. Поэтому рекомендуется использовать только основные стили и не полагаться на сложные дизайны.
Также следует учитывать безопасность при отправке сообщений электронной почты с помощью PHP. Необходимо проверять и очищать введенные пользователем данные, чтобы предотвратить возможность внедрения вредоносного кода или отправки спама.